Felicity ESS, a brand of Guangdong Felicity New Energy Co Ltd, was founded in 2014 and specialises in energy storage systems for residential and commercial markets. The company has built a presence across Africa, Southeast Asia, and Oceania, with products designed for markets where grid reliability is variable — experience that translates well to regional Australian communities.
Felicity's LUX-X series battery systems use LFP chemistry and are designed for integration with the company's own hybrid inverter range. The modular battery design allows configurations from approximately 5 kWh to 20+ kWh, with off-grid capability built in as standard rather than as an add-on.
In the Australian market, Felicity products are distributed through established solar wholesalers and have achieved CEC approval for multiple models. The company does not maintain a dedicated Australian office, with support handled through its distribution network. Felicity targets cost-conscious buyers, particularly those in regional areas or off-grid properties who need backup and off-grid capability at a competitive price point.

Felicity's home batteries use LFP cells. LFP (lithium iron phosphate) is the most common residential chemistry in WA for its long cycle life and stability in Perth's heat.
WA's rebate ($130/kWh, up to $1,300) depends on the system pairing with a Synergy-approved (SSL) inverter — eligibility is set by the inverter, not the battery brand. Whether a given Felicity system qualifies depends on the inverter it's installed with, so confirm the pairing with your installer.
